What are the skills needed in tomorrow’s workplace? How do we encourage an enterprising mindset that allows young people to have a go, take risks and pick themselves up from setbacks?

With all these questions in mind, Wimbledon High School has recruited its first Head of Enterprise, Entrepreneurship and Employability. Dr Sheela Sharma joins the Futures team with over 15 years’ experience in the corporate and start-up sectors, driving business growth and transformational change. She holds an MSc in Neuroscience from the University of Manchester and a DPhil in Clinical Medicine from the University of Oxford.

“I am passionate about instilling both the confidence and skills in young women needed to help them navigate their careers and reach their full potential - from networking and calculated risk-taking to entrepreneurial thinking.

“According to the Rose Review into female entrepreneurship only one in three entrepreneurs in the UK are women, and closing this gender gap could add £250bn in gross value to the UK economy. Imposter syndrome, which stops us taking risks for fear of failure, likely plays a major part in the gender inequality among entrepreneurs. We need to change this and where better to start than Wimbledon High School? Not everyone wants to go into business, granted, but the skills of entrepreneurship (problem solving, creative thinking, leadership and developing financial acumen) will stand all students in good stead as they move to life beyond school.

“We will be looking at new ways of exposing the girls to the multitude of career opportunities available to them and examining how entrepreneurial skills are key to thriving in all workplaces.”
